In the situation in which you drive in the area of the occurrence of an accident investigated by the police, you must continue your movement with attention, respecting the indications of the traffic police officer. It must be known that in the case in which you encounter the sign “Accident” you have the obligation to drive with maximum 30 km/h in the urban area or 50 km/h outside the urban area.
In such situations you must drive with attention and reduced speed, not with increased speed. The speed will be increased only at the signal of the traffic police officer who investigates the accident, through the brisk rotation of the arm.
Stopping at the place of the accident is not recommended, to see what happened, as long as the police is already at the place of the accident, thus avoiding an even greater congestion of the area. But it must be known that any person who has knowledge about a road accident following which one or more persons were injured has the obligation to notify the police and to call the single emergency number 112.

Regulation** - Article 123
The driver of a vehicle is obliged to drive with a speed which must not exceed 30 km/h in the urban area or 50 km/h outside the urban area, in the following situations:

g) in the action area of the warning sign “Children” in the time interval 7:00-22:00, as well as of the sign “Accident”;

Regulation** - Article 88
(1) The signals of the police officer who directs the traffic have the following meanings:

e) the brisk rotation of the arm signifies the increase of the speed of movement of vehicles or the hurrying of the crossing of the road by pedestrians.

OUG* - Article 77

(2) Any person who is involved or has knowledge about the occurrence of a road accident following which the death or injury of one or more persons resulted, as well as in the situation in which a vehicle which transports dangerous goods is involved in the event, is obliged to notify immediately the police and to call the national single number for emergency calls 112, existing in the telephone networks in Romania.

* OUG = GOVERNMENT EMERGENCY ORDINANCE no. 195 of December 12, 2002 updated (Road Traffic Code)
** Regulation = REGULATION for the implementation of OUG 195/2002 updated (Road Traffic Code Regulation)
